Abstract

The aim of the study was radiodensitometric avaluation of cronic periapical changes with densitometric measurements. The material comprised 60 teeth with chronic apical periodontitis, 30 male - 30 female, age ranked from 20 - 65 years. During preparation the canals were lubricated with 2.5 % sodium hypochlorite solution and filled with gutta-percha points and AH PLUS. Before treatment and after one year lesions in hard tissues of the periapical area were detected on radiograms and radiodensitometry. Bone radiodensitometry measured with “TROPHY-RWGUI” DIGITAL X-RAY- system, ranged from 0-256. Before endodontic treatment bone density was 105.1 ± 28.5 and after treatment different values were measured. Control radiograms and radiodensitometry were done after one year and showed increased mineralisation changes in the periapical area. The results were statistically significant. After one year of therapy average bone density was 139.2 ± 39.4; p < 0.0001. Following adequate endodontic treatment radiodensitometric measurements proved to be useful in evaluation of chronic periapical changes.
